In 1901, Karl Landsteiner classified blood into four blood groups. This system is called ABO system. It is based on the presence or absence of a surface antigen, on the surface of red blood cells. According to this, there are four blood groups, A , B, AB and O. The A blood group has A antigen, B blood group has B antigen. AB has both whereas O blood group has no antigen on RBC surface.
